Last week GoDaddy announced the opening of their online Marketplace. That’s right, you can now sell on shop for goods at Godaddy . I emailed them for additional information and they responded in less than 24 hours. That was a great start.
The following is their response to my questions:
Q: Whateverebay: “Payment methods accepted?”
A: GoDaddy: The same payment methods that can be used with GoDaddy.com can be used through this storefront.
We currently accept four forms of payment. They are as follows:
• Credit Card
• Online Check (U.S. banks only)
• GoodAsGold (You can add funds to your GoodAsGold account by check, Money orders or wire transfers)
• PayPal* (Online Payment)
Unfortunately, we do not accept this form of payment:
• Cash

We also allow for payment by Personal or Business Check drawn off of a U.S. bank account.
In order to use a check for a purchase on our site, you would need the following information:
1. Bank Routing Number
2. Checking Account Number
If your checking account is a Business Account, you would also need to input the name of the company when filling in the check information. If the checking account is a Personal Account, then your Driver’s License Number, Issuing State, and your Date of Birth would be required.
We also offer our GoodAsGold payment option. Here’s how it works:
1. Set up your GoodAsGold plan.
2. Download complete, easy to understand instructions on how to do a wire transfer.
3. Wire transfer and stock your GoodAsGold plan with cash to spend, $100 is the minimum.
4. We email you confirmation that your GoodAsGold plan is set.

Q: Whateverebay: Can the merchant use their own checkout?
A: GoDaddy: You must use our checkout for this storefront
Q: Whateverebay: How can they promote their store? Badges, widgets, Google?
A: GoDaddy: Currently, you cannot integrate other advertising products into this application. We will market the site in general as the Go Daddy Marketplace, but you will should still do your own targeted advertising to draw people to your store.
Q: Whateverebay: Can we also promote our own website on your site?
A: GoDaddy: Advertising will not cross to GoDaddy.com, only promotions for the Marketplace as a whole.
The above answer is vague. I was able to confirm that you are allowed to promote your site. You can include links to your website.

Take a look at the fine print:
“10% commission fee applied to all sales. A credit card is required to open a Go Daddy Marketplace account. Vendors issuing refunds will receive a return of 70% of the original commission charged; orders with credit card chargebacks are subject to a $25 fee and will result in no return of original commission.”
A $25.00 fee in the event of a chargeback is usually what would pay your Merchant Account. This varies on the length and type of relationship you have with your bank.
